百度试题 结果1 题目问题描述:求一个3*3矩阵对角线元素之和.提示:利用双重for循环控制输入二维数数组a,在将a[i][i]累加后输出 相关知识点: 试题来源: 解析 晕.main(){int i,j;int a[3][3];int result = 0;for(i=0;i反馈 收藏
因为一共有两条对角线 究竟是求那条对角线上的元素之和 还是求所有处于对角线上的元素之和是不明确的 int a[3][3],sum=0; …… for(i=0;i<3;i++) for(j=0;j<3;j++) scanf("%3d",&a[ i ][j]); …… 评:那个3明显是愚蠢的作茧自缚 ...
define n 3 int main(){ int i,j,a[n][n],sum=0;printf("请输入矩阵(3*3):\n");for(i=0;i<n;i++)for(j=0;j<n;j++)scanf("%d",&a[i][j]);for(i=0;i<n;i++)sum+=a[i][i];printf("对角线之和为:%d\n",sum);return 0;} C++ 代码 include<iostream> incl...
int main(void) { int a = 0, b = 0, n;for (int i = 1; i <= 9; i++) { scanf("%d", &n);if (i == 1 || i == 5 || i == 9)a += n;if (i == 3 || i == 5 || i == 7)b += n;} printf("%d %d", a, b);} ...
int sumL(int a[3][3]); /*左起对角线累加函数声明*/ int sumR(int a[3][3]); /*右起对角线累加函数声明*/ for (i=0;i<3;i++)for (j=0;j<3;j++)scanf("%d",&a[j]); /*输入10个整数*/ //===这里应改为:scanf("%d", &a[i][j]);//===原先a[i][j]未被...
for(int i=3; i f = f2; f2 = f1 + f2; f1 = f; System.out.print("第" + i +"个月的兔子对数: "); System.out.println(" " + f2); } } } /*【程序2】 * 作者 若水飞天 题目:判断101-200之间有多少个素数,并输出所有素数。
各种排序的性能如下图所示: 【程序29】 题目:求一个3*3矩阵对角线元素之和 1.程序分析:利用双重for循环控制输入二维数组,再将a[i][i]累加后输 出。 解答: 为具有一般性,现设计自主输入n*n的矩阵,并求出对角线元素之和。 import java.io.*; import java.util.*; public class Text29 { public static...
已经改好了:include <stdio.h> void main(){ int a[3][3],i,j;for(i=0;i<3;i++)for(j=0;j<3;j++)a[i][j]=i*3+j+1;for(i=0;i<3;i++){ for(j=0;j<3;j++){ if(i==j)printf("%d ",a[i][j]);else printf(" ");} printf("\n");} } ...
如果你只是需要知道这个可对角化的矩阵相似于一个什么对角矩阵的话,只要对角线元素是8,2,2这三个数即可,不管顺序如何. 分析总结。 一个可对角化的矩阵代入特征方程ea后得出来的假设有3个那么最后得出来的对角矩阵主对角线上的元素也是这三个怎么判断这三个元素在对角矩阵里面的排列顺序是哪个先哪个后呢结果...